Experience Embedded

Professionelle Schulungen, Beratung und Projektunterstützung

EXPERIENCE EMBEDDED

MicroConsult ist Ihr Partner für Embedded Systems Engineering - professionelle Schulungen, Beratung und Projektunterstützung.

Vom Mikrocontroller bis zum Systemdesign, Sie profitieren von unserer jahrzehntelangen Erfahrung. Maßgeschneiderter Knowhow-Transfer für Ihre Projektziele – nah am Menschen, nah an der Praxis.

x

+++++++++++++++++++++++++++++++++++++

WICHTIGER HINWEIS:

Auch an unserem Trainings- und Coaching-Angebot geht die aktuelle Situation nicht spurlos vorüber. Von Präsenz-Services müssen wir aktuell absehen. Doch zum Glück lassen sich die meisten unserer Themen sehr gut als Live Online-Formate vermitteln.

Sprechen Sie uns an – gemeinsam finden wir eine Lösung: 
+49 (0) 89 450617-71 oder info@microconsult.de.

+++++++++++++++++++++++++++++++++++++

Embedded-Software: Analyse, Design, Architektur


Die wichtigsten Erfolgsfaktoren für Ihre Embedded-Projekte

Professionelles Software Engineering ist der Schlüssel zu profitablen und qualitativ hochwertigen Embedded-Softwarelösungen. Dazu gehören zunächst die systematische Analyse der Kundenanforderungen und das Design oder die Modellierung einer tragfähigen Softwarearchitektur. Wie kommen Sie zu aussagefähigen und möglichst vollständigen Requirements? Wie entsteht eine tragfähige Embedded-Architektur, und wie lässt sie sich erhalten? Wichtige Fragen zum Thema Analyse und Design von Embedded-Software, auf die wir Antworten geben.

Echtzeit: Embedded-Programmierung, Betriebssysteme


Expertenwissen für Ihre Software-Implementierung

Die Implementierung der Requirements und der Embedded-Architektur setzt hervorragende Kenntnisse der Echtzeitprogrammierung mit Programmiersprachen wie Embedded C oder Embedded C++ sowie von Echtzeitbetriebssystemen (RTOS) voraus. Der routinierte und systematische Einsatz von Debuggern und Testwerkzeugen sorgt dafür, dass Ihre Embedded-Software die Qualitätsanforderungen erfüllt. Erfahren Sie mehr darüber, wie Sie Programmiersprachen, Programmiermethoden und RTOS (Echtzeitbetriebssysteme) für Echtzeitanforderungen optimal einsetzen.

Mikrocontroller: Multicore, Singlecore, Peripherie


Das richtige Bausteinwissen führt Sie in kürzester Zeit zu Ihrer Applikation

Mikrocontroller, ob Singlecore oder Multicore, sind das Herz der meisten Embedded-Lösungen. Es ist von großer Bedeutung, dass Sie die Architektur Ihres Mikrocontrollers und seine Entwicklungsumgebung verstehen. Dann können Sie auch die Funktionalität und Leistung von Singlecore, Multicore und Peripherie effektiv für eine erfolgreiche Embedded-Lösung erschließen. Wie Sie das Optimum aus Ihrem Mikrocontroller mit vertretbarem Aufwand herausholen, erfahren Sie in unseren zahlreichen Trainings und anderen Wissensangeboten.

Test, Qualität und Safety von Embedded-Software


Mit modernen Methoden erreichen Sie Ihre vorgegebenen Qualitätsziele

Der gesamte Entwicklungsprozess bis hin zum lieferfertigen Embedded-System wird von Qualitätssicherungsmaßnahmen und Test begleitet. Sie stellen sicher, dass alle funktionalen und nichtfunktionalen Anforderungen sowie evtl. auch jene einer Norm (Safety) nachweislich erfüllt werden. Die verschiedenen Testebenen, wie Unit-Test, Integrationstest, Systemtest, Abnahmetest und Zertifizierung, sorgen am Ende für einen erfolgreichen Projektabschluss mit zufriedenen Kunden. Sie erfahren, wo Sie im (agilen) Entwicklungsprozess welches Testverfahren mit welchen Tools einsetzen, so dass die geforderte Produktqualität nachweisbar erfüllt ist. Das Einhalten von Safety-Normen erfüllt die Forderung, nach dem aktuellen Stand der Wissenschaft und Technik gearbeitet zu haben.

Events

Schaffen Sie sich Orientierung für eine zukunftssichere Entwicklungsarbeit.

ESE Kongess >

Ausbildungspfade

Wählen Sie den Weg, der am besten zu Ihnen passt

Ausbildungspfade: Übersicht >

AURIX™ TC2xx Workshop: 32-Bit Multicore-Mikrocontroller-Familie

Sie lernen die Architektur, wesentliche On-chip-Peripherie und Besonderheiten (insbes. der Multicore-Architektur und Safety-Erweiterungen) der der ersten Generation der Bausteinfamilie AURIX™ kennen. Sie können Low-Level-Treiber für diese Hardware programmieren, adaptieren und mit einem Debugger testen. Ferner sind Sie in der Lage, Interrupts und Traps zu steuern.


Nächster Termin: 04.-08.05.2020

Zum Training: AURIX™ TC2xx Workshop: 32-Bit Multicore-Mikrocontroller-Familie

Embedded-Linux-Architektur: Kernel-Treiberentwicklung

Wie entwickle ich einen Kernel-Treiber? Auf was muss ich bei Embedded- und Echtzeit-Systemen achten? Essentiell für die Entwicklung eines performanten Treibers ist ein grundlegendes Verständnis der Kernel-Architektur. Genau hier setzt dieses Embedded-Linux-Training an. In der Übung wird ein Grundgerüst für einen Kernel-Treiber sukzessive um die besprochenen Mechanismen erweitert. Am Ende des Trainings haben Sie einen kompletten Treiber erstellt und sind in der Lage, in Ihrem Projekt Treiber zu entwickeln.


Nächster Termin: 20.-23.04.2020

Zum Training: Embedded-Linux-Architektur: Kernel-Treiberentwicklung

SysML: Modellbasierte Systemanalyse und Systemdesign mit der Systems Modeling Language

Mit dem erworbenen Wissen können Sie die Analyse & das Design für Systeme (bestehend aus Mechanik, HW, SW und anderen Entwicklungsdomänen) mit der SysML in Ihrem Projekt umzusetzen - von den Anforderungen bis zur verifizierten Systemarchitektur. Sie kennen die praxisrelevanten Systemsichten und die Aspekte von Model-based Systems Engineering (MBSE).

Nächster Termin: 27.-29.04.2020

Zum Training: SysML: Modellbasierte Systemanalyse und Systemdesign mit der Systems Modeling Language

Software-Projektmanagement: Erfolgreiches Führen von Projektteams durch alle Projektphasen

Nach dem Software-Projektmanagement-Seminar beherrschen Sie die Methoden und Vorgehensweisen für das erfolgreiche Führen von Projektteams durch alle Projektphasen in Entwicklungsprojekten. Das Wissen wenden Sie zur Optimierung Ihres eigenen Projektes an.

Nächster Termin: 20.-24.04.2020

Zum Training: Software-Projektmanagement

Embedded Trainings von Spezialisten für Spezialisten

In unserem Trainingszentrum in München schaffen wir die Bedingungen, die Sie sich für eine professionelle Weiterbildung wünschen.


Ihre Vorteile:

*Professionelle Schulungen mit hohem Praxisanteil
*Ungestörtes Lernen in persönlicher Atmosphäre
*Inspirierender Erfahrungsaustausch mit Branchenkollegen

Über 40 Jahre Erfahrung gewährleisten eine auf Ihre Praxisbedürfnisse optimierte Vermittlung aktueller Themen.

 

Machen Sie sich schlau - Überblick über unsere Trainings

Gesucht: TRAINER & BERATER

SIE suchen eine attraktive, herausfordernde Tätigkeit mit Entwicklungsperspektiven? Und arbeiten gerne in einem motivierten, netten Team?

WIR suchen hier Unterstützung:

*Mikrocontroller & Embedded-Software
*Linux & Yocto
*Python
*Programmiersprachen


Wir schätzen Ihr Expertenwissen und machen Sie zum Multiplikator in der Embedded-Branche!

Mehr Infos finden Sie hier.

MicroConsult ist offizieller Trainingspartner von

Unsere Partner - Quelle für intensiven Erfahrungsaustausch, innovative Ideen, hilfreiche Tools, nützliche Praxisbeispiele

Hätte ich das Training "Embedded-Linux-Architektur: Kernel-Treiberentwicklung" vier Wochen früher gehabt, hätte ich eine Woche Fehlersuche gespart!

 


Hubert Streidl, Bosch Sicherheitssysteme GmbH Mehr >